Types of Tons: Short Ton vs. Long Ton

The existence of different ton units stems from historical variations in measurement systems.

  • Short Ton (US ton): This is the most commonly used ton in the United States and is equal to 2000 pounds. This is the ton you'll most likely encounter in everyday American contexts, from shipping and construction to agricultural applications.

  • Long Ton (Imperial Ton or UK ton): Primarily used in the United Kingdom and certain parts of the Commonwealth, the long ton is equivalent to 2240 pounds. This difference of 240 pounds arises from historical definitions and remains a crucial distinction to avoid errors in international trade and engineering projects.

Conversion Formulas: Pounds to Tons

Now, let's break down the formulas for converting pounds to both short and long tons:

1. Pounds to Short Tons:

The conversion formula is simple:

Short Tons = Pounds / 2000

As an example, to convert 4000 pounds to short tons:

Short Tons = 4000 lbs / 2000 lbs/ton = 2 short tons

2. Pounds to Long Tons:

The conversion for long tons is equally straightforward:

Long Tons = Pounds / 2240

Here's one way to look at it: to convert 4480 pounds to long tons:

Long Tons = 4480 lbs / 2240 lbs/ton = 2 long tons

Frequently Asked Questions (FAQ)

Q: What is the most common type of ton used in the United States?

A: The short ton (2000 pounds) is the most common type of ton used in the United States.

Q: How do I convert pounds to metric tons (tonne)?

A: A metric ton (or tonne) is equal to 1000 kilograms. To convert pounds to metric tons, first convert pounds to kilograms (1 lb ≈ 0.453592 kg), then divide by 1000.
